Handover — Torbin to incoming contractor, Pellgrove queue team. Log compaction on the Wrenmill message queue runs nightly; it merges segment files older than 48 hours and drops tombstoned keys. If compaction stalls, check disk headroom on the broker nodes first — that's the usual culprit. The compactor's maintenance console is behind a recovery lock after the last incident; nothing else needs special access. To open the console and resume or roll back a stuck compaction job, use the passphrase written just below.

recovery phrase for bawep-kawef: oliath-casdor

Welcome to the Pixelcrate thumbnail pipeline. The generation queue runs on the Farrowmill cluster and drains roughly every ninety seconds; stuck jobs older than ten minutes are requeued automatically by the sweeper. If the sweeper itself dies, restart it from the ops console under Queues > Thumbs. Unlocking the sweeper's sealed config requires the recovery passphrase, which is recorded directly below this paragraph.

vault phrase of bagaf-kajeg = jorath-feniel-briir-siliel-ralix

Symptom: `test_settlement_retry` and `test_idempotent_capture` fail ~1 in 12 runs. Cause: sandbox ledger emulator races the fixture teardown. Do not retry blindly; masked a real double-capture bug once.

Mitigation: pin emulator to single worker, set `LEDGER_SYNC=strict`, bump fixture timeout to 30s. If failures persist past three reruns, escalate to the Tallygate on-call, not the plugin channel. Attach the failing run's artifacts and quote the build token printed directly below.

pipeline stamp: htk3_cc5

Hey — handing off the waveform preview feature in Tonedeck before your review. The renderer takes uploaded audio, downsamples it server-side, and spits out an SVG preview. Worth scrutinizing: we parse user-supplied files with a third-party decoder, and the temp files land in a shared scratch dir. Priya sandboxed the decoder last sprint but it's half-done. Threat notes and the sandbox config are on the internal review page.

wiki page, hahif-hahif: https://argocd.kelvisys.corp/browse/board/settings/pages/1442e0b1065d83f1